Oxytocin Peptide Protocols & Precautions
Oxytocin Peptide is a research compound not approved for human use — all information presented here is provided solely for educational purposes. Storage requirements: lyophilised Oxytocin Peptide at minus 20°C, reconstituted solution stored refrigerated and used within 30 days — reconstitute only with bacteriostatic water.
